AMORY, MISSISSIPPI: 'American Idol' Season 21 is getting more intense as the finale episode is at the door. The viewers have voted for their favorite top 10 contestants and Colin Stough was among those who secured a spot in the Top 10.

Colin is all set to vie in the Judge's contestants round to advance to the Top 7. However, social media users have dug up a bit about Colin and found some controversial Instagram and Facebook posts that made them question his character. Although Colin has now taken down his previous posts, the internet slammed him for his 'disgusting' behavior. They even compared Colin with 'American Idol' alum Caleb Kennedy.

Colin Stough's controversial posts resurfaced

Colin shared a meme in June 2021 which recently resurfaced on the internet. In the post, an African-American man with sagging pants was contrasted with the Confederate War Memorial statue that was erected in 1906 in Covington, Georgia. Colin wrote in the caption, "How does a statue being in the same place for 100 years suddenly become offensive and men walking around in public with there [sic] a** showing not offensive? Are people really this ignorant?" However, this is not the only controversial post that Colin had shared in the past. The Sun reported that Colin was tagged in a December 2020 post from D.T.D (Deer Turkey & Ducks) Outdoors & Monroe County Whitetails Unlimited, a nonprofit that supports the hunting and shooting of wild animals.

The caption of the post reads, "Congratulations!!! Colin Stough for getting a little predator control done and meat in the freezer." Colin also shared the same photo on his social media and appeared to hold a large wild cat he had hunted and killed. In the third controversial post, Colin shared a story titled, "Donald Trump says flying the Confederate flag is 'freedom of speech'," in July 2020. A Reddit user shared the post and accused Colin of 'supporting' the Confederate flag, which many US citizens now consider to be a racist symbol. However, soon after noticing the backlash, Colin deleted all his previous social media posts.
